Color Coated Steel Coil for Household Appliances
The color coated steel plate for household appliances has good processing performance and decoration performance. It is widely used as the front panel, side panel, rear panel and inner panel of household appliances. Due to its rich colors and high production efficiency, color-coated steel plates are widely used in exterior walls, roofs, interior decoration, doors and windows, etc. They are also very popular in transportation, home appliances and other fields. The home appliance color coated steel plate uses a special finish to make the surface shiny. The front panel is coated with high molecular linear oil-free polyester resin, and the rear panel is coated with modified epoxy coating.

Galvanized Corrugated Roof Sheet
Galvanized roof shingles are made of galvanized steel sheet used for roofing and coated with zinc. The zinc coating provides moisture and oxygen protection for the base steel. According to the galvanizing process, it can be divided into hot-dip galvanized steel plate and electro-galvanized steel plate. The corrugated design will improve its strength and enable it to withstand harsh weather conditions. Common designs include wavy, trapezoidal designs, ribbed galvanized roof panels, etc. It can be used as a single-layer board, covering an existing roof, or a steel sandwich panel.
Color Coated Galvalume Steel Coil PPGL
PPGL steel is a durable, colorful and economical building material. It is the abbreviation of color coated aluminum-zinc plated steel plate, which is based on aluminum-zinc plated steel plate. The aluminum-zinc coated steel is then continuously painted in coil form. Due to its heat resistance and corrosion resistance, it has become a material for various construction purposes, especially roofs and walls.

Aluminum tube refers to a metal tubular material made by extruding pure aluminum or aluminum alloy into a hollow shape along its longitudinal length. Aluminum tubes can have one or more closed through holes, with uniform wall thickness and cross-section, and are usually delivered in straight lines or rolls. Aluminum tubes are widely used in industries such as automobiles, ships, aviation, electrical appliances, agriculture, mechatronics, and home furnishings
Aluminum alloy profiles are metal materials with specific cross-sectional shapes made mainly of aluminum through processes such as melting, extrusion, and surface treatment. There are mainly specifications such as 60 series, 70 series, 90 series, 105 series, 110 series, 118 series, 120 series, 125 series, etc. Among them, 60 series, 70 series, and 90 series are more commonly used. The thickness specifications include 0.8, 0.9, 1.0, 1.2, 1.4, 1.5, 2.0, 3.0, etc. Its characteristics of light weight, corrosion resistance, high strength, and easy processing make it widely used in fields such as construction, transportation, electronic appliances, and industrial equipment.
